| ❌ Mistake | ✅ Correct Approach |
|---|---|
| Using standard fasteners without allowance for thermal expansion. | Employ oversized holes or slotted fasteners to accommodate polycarbonate's thermal expansion and contraction, preventing stress cracking. |
| Drilling holes too close to the edge. | Maintain adequate edge distance (minimum 1.5 times the sheet thickness) to prevent tearing or stress concentration. |
